Bryce Dallas Howard Teases Exciting Direction for Jurassic World 2


Bryce Dallas Howard says Jurassic World 2 will go in an exciting, unexpected direction, JoBloreports. Her character, Claire, will be greatly changed by the events of the last movie. However, Howard says at her core she's still the same person.

"That's part of the story, that's part of the journey. She definitely went through a lot and is permanently changed because of that," Howard said of Claire. "But she is also who she is. Chris [Pratt] and I are already having a lot of fun with that."

She said, "We're in that stage right now of figuring out the backstory and talking through all those beats, like everything that happened in between. That's always such a fun time. You're like, ‘No, she did that?! No way, he couldn't have!' It's really, really fun, and then you step into the present moment and it becomes alive."

When discussing the new direction the movie is going in, Howard said, "I think what is tricky about doing the fifth movie of a franchise is how will you bring in new stuff and still pay tribute to what we all know and the legacy of the film. So, it's the balance between the new stuff and the old stuff."

She talked a bit about Colin Treverrow, the director of the movie. "I think Colin did a great job in the first one finding the balance between what people are expecting and what people are being again. I was kind of surprised when he pitched me the story because it leads the story to a place that we've never seen before and it brings some of the most important elements from the other films and makes something with them. I thought that was very interesting. It's the second chapter of a trilogy so it gets the story to a place that wants you leaving more and more."

Jurassic World 2 will be released June 22, 2018.
